I picked up this Cowan Creek Cattle King 4 1/4" Stockman on Ebay this week, total with shipping was $10.00 and I was amazed at the quality. It rivals Case for fit and finish and the factory edges were scary sharp. 440A is the biggest drawback, and the brown jigged bone is identical to that on Rough Riders, but I have searched all the forums and googled trying to find the importer, and came up empty.

So far it appears they make just a Trapper, Congress and this large Stockman. And so far I have only seen them in this brown bone. Makes me think whoever is the importer, it's a fairly small time operation. As of a few minutes ago, I only find 16 Cowan Creek knives on Ebay, most other chinese imports you get hundreds when you search by brand name.
